WORTH, R. N.,

This index refers to a page containing the a biography of John BULTEEL and merely says:
"Mr. WORTH  in his 'West Country Garland,' says, 'The Family of  BULTEEL is of French origin, and has long been settled in Devonshire'.
But he is also referred to in the Introduction (p.vi}as follows:
"Another work often referred to in this volume is 'The West-Country Garland,' selected from the writings of the poets of Devon and Cornwall from the fifteenth to the nineteenth century, by R.N. WORTH, F.G.S., London, 1875. This work consisted of 175 pages and dealt with seventy-four writers, and as far as it goes it is a very reliable work.  Mr. WORTH, however, limits his biographical references to two or three lines, but his selections are most judicious, and the whole work is most useful, his introductory chapter being full of interesting information concerning West-Country bibliography."

Transcribed from: Wright, W. H. K.,(1896) West-Country Poets: Their Lives and Works, p.64. London: Elliot Stock, pp.48-51
